From the ground, all you really see up on the roofing system are tiles that cover it, perhaps some pipes or vents, and possibly the gutters. However, just like the majority of things in life, there's more taking place than it seems. A total roof has several different materials, each with their very own objective in maintaining your roofing system risk-free from leaks and other damages.


Your roofing outdoor decking is the base layer of your roofing system. It's assembled of multiple boards that are either plywood, or oriented hair boards (OSB), and work as the link between your roof covering products and the frame of your house. The decking (sometimes likewise called sheathing) is nailed or stapled right into the structure's rafters, and roof covering materials are installed in addition to it.

The materials that we'll be going over are underlayment, ice/water guard, and flashing. Underlayment is a waterproof layer, typically presented and pin down straight onto the roofing system decking before various other roof materials. The underlayment is actually the last line of protection that your decking has, and serves to secure it from water obtaining via any minor scrapes and holes in your top layer of roof shingles, particularly as an outcome of wind-driven rainfall.

Ice/water shield is essentially a beefed-up underlayment, with rubberized asphalt and an adhesive that allows it to be turned out safeguarded without penetrating the surface area with nails or staples. This material is most often made use of in locations that are very conscious leakages, and where water invests a great deal of time.


Also made use of in these locations, especially around infiltrations, is blinking. Flashing is a thin, flexible metal that is utilized in several different means, in several various locations of the roofing, usually to cover spaces between roofing surface areas. The most common locations where you'll discover flashing are at walls or smokeshafts, around vents and skylights, and occasionally in open valleys, where there isn't any kind of tile cover, and flashing is positioned rather

Trickle edge is a specially created kind of blinking that is installed below the initial layer of roof shingles to stop water from flowing in reverse below the roof covering materials, and right into your fascia.


Without it, the lower edges of your roof will be subjected to loads of water, drastically shortening its life, and increasing the job you'll require to have actually done throughout a roofing substitute.
